French doors

French doors are a great way to bring in more light and to blend your interior and exterior areas. You can pick from solid oak, uPVC, or aluminium doors. They are easy to maintain and energy efficient. They are easy to clean and can be adapted to fit your home.

They are fitted with knuckle-reduced hinges, slave locking shootbolts and multipoint locks for an excellent level of security.

The frames are broken thermally and the weather seals are the most advanced in technology. This prevents heat loss. These features help them attain A+ energy ratings and U-values of 0.9W/m2K. These are custom-designed and include toughened glass and argon cavity insulation. The powder coating is tough and low-maintenance.
